About the Role
Our client is a leading company in the aviation industry and is seeking to employ a Sales Operations Manager.
Purpose of Position
Manage and optimise the Sales Operations team to support the sales team through every stage of the sales process to shorten sales cycles and maximise conversion. Collaborate with the sales team and continuously analyse the sales experience to identify and implement improvements in sales processes, sales systems, tools, support, and other opportunities to drive revenue growth and improve sales productivity.
Working closely with internal stakeholders, including Finance and IT, to accelerate speed to market while ensuring that all processes, documents, and communications are compliant with internal policies and regulatory requirements.
Serve as a subject matter expert on the company's program, sales processes, and product terms and support internal stakeholders and the sales team on complex deal structures.
Key Responsibilities
Team Management
- Train and manage the Sales Operations team to excel in their role in supporting the Sales team throughout the sales cycle. This includes but is not limited to proposal generation, operational queries, providing flight quotes, improving pipeline management processes, and creating reports and dashboards.
- Develop and coach the Sales Operations team, providing strategic guidance, tactical support, performance feedback, and career development to enhance team productivity and engagement.
- Lead recruitment efforts to attract and hire top talent.
- Lead and motivate team members in their areas of expertise and through performance metrics, driving for a culture of excellence and results.
- Accountable for the effective use of the budget allocated to the Sales Operations team.

Sales Optimisation
- Improve operational efficiency, customer experience, and sales productivity by implementing improvements in the sales process, including automation opportunities, resolving obstacles, and creating synergies across the sales function.
- Lead high-priority projects, including proposal updates and RFPs to facilitate consistent and effective communication of the company's value proposition.
- In collaboration with the Legal department and Data Privacy Specialist, ensure Legal and GDPR compliance in all processes.
- Collaborate with cross-functional teams to implement Sales initiatives.

Sales Systems Management
- Oversee CRM implementation and management, balancing user experience and management visibility requirements.
- Ensure compliance and best practices usage of Sales Systems, including Salesforce and Conga.
- Work closely with IT to support the development, implementation, and use of technology within the Sales team, address technical issues, and integrate systems to improve efficiency of sales processes.
- Other duties can be performed subject to being within the same professional career, considered related, or functionally linked.
Personal Specification
- Minimum 5 years’ experience managing a Sales Operations team (preferred)
- Experience with Salesforce
- Proficient in MS Office Suite
- Ability to interpret and utilize complex data
- Fluency in Business English (written and spoken)
- Strong communicator and collaborator with experience in cross-department communications
- Detail oriented with strong organizational skills
- Ability to thrive in a fast-paced, changing environment
- Strong problem-solving and decision-making abilities
- Adaptable to evolving company needs
